
Evri is planning to increase the capacity of its Southampton centre as part of a wider £36m investment.
The upgrade is part of the company’s UK-wide plan to strengthen its network in preparation for this year’s peak period.
Martijn de Lange, chief executive of the Evri Group, said: "Following a historic year for Evri, with our acquisition of Coll-8 in Ireland and our landmark merger with DHL, which is due to complete imminently, we continue to invest significantly in our operation to ensure we deliver the best possible service to our clients and customers, especially at the busiest time of the year for our industry.
"We’re on track to become the UK’s premier parcel delivery business."

Evri is also expanding its Barnsley superhub, including a £4m investment in a new small item sorter and a £25m third-tier upgrade.
This will enable the site to process up to 5.5m parcels per day by Christmas 2026.
